
مسار تطوير الواجهة الأمامية
تعلم أساسيات CSS
مراجعات

+500 طالب

17 اختبار

مبتديء
- وصف الدورة
- منهج الدورة
- عن المعلم
- مراجعات
هل تتطلع إلى أن تصبح خبيرا في تصميم الويب؟
في دورة أساسيات CSS - سواء كنت جديدا في تطوير الويب أو تتطلع إلى البناء على مهاراتك الحالية - ستساعدك هذه الدورة على إنشاء مواقع ويب مذهلة وسريعة الاستجابة تميزك عن أقرانك.
هل سئمت من الشعور بأن قدراتك في تصميم الويب محدودة؟
في هذه الدورة ستتعلم كيفية استخدام CSS لتصميم كل عنصر من عناصر موقع الويب الخاص بك، والتي تشمل النصوص والروابط مرورا بالصور والمزيد.
لست متأكدا من أين تبدأ؟
تبدأ دورتنا بمقدمة تعلمك أساسيات CSS المضمنة "Inline" والداخلية "Internal" والخارجية" External"، وكيفية استخدامها لجعل موقعك يبدو في أبهى حالاته. لكننا لن نتوقف عند هذا الحد! تغطي دورتنا كل شيء بدءا من تصميم النص والجمع بين المحددات "selectors" إلى العمل مع الألوان وحل التعارض بين المحددات. ومع التغطية المتعمقة لنموذج صندوق CSS، ستتعلم كيفية إضافة الأبعاد، والهوامش "margins"، والحشوات "paddings"، وكيفية استخدام تحديد الموضع المطلق "absolute positioning" لإنشاء تصميمات لافتة للنظر.
في نهاية الدورة، ستتمكن من إنشاء مواقع ويب ذات مظهر احترافي بسهولة باستخدام أحدث التقنيات وأفضل الممارسات لنقل صفحات الويب الخاصة بك إلى ما هو أبعد من مجرد النص الأسود على خلفية بيضاء!
فماذا تنتظر؟ اشترك الآن وابدأ التعلم واتخذ خطوتك الأولى كي تصبح محترفًا في CSS!
محتوى الدورة
عرض الكل
محتوى قسم
0% مكتمل
0/22 خطوة
محتوى قسم
0% مكتمل
0/9 خطوة
محتوى قسم
0% مكتمل
0/11 خطوة

م. محمد أبو سريع
مهندس برمجيات ذو خبرة أكثر من عشر سنوات في كبرى شركات الخليج وأوروبا. يعمل حاليًا ككبير مهندسي البرمجيات في شركة رائدة في مجال تصنيع الأدوية والتكنولوجيا الحيوية. لديه خبرة كبيرة في تطوير الواجهات الأمامية، بجانب خبرته في إلقاء المحاضرات في الجامعات المختلفة، وقناته التعليمية على اليوتيوب التي يشرح فيها البرمجة وعلومها بطريقة مبسطة.
التقييمات والمراجعات


والأحسان ومتعة التعلم وثراء المحتوي
اللهم بارك ، ماشاء الله ، حابب أشكر م.محمد أبو سربع وكل المشاركين في هذا العمل العظيم ، علي المجهود المحترم والخرافي في تبسيط المعلومة ، وجمال العرض ، حرفيا كل ثانية في الفديو بتكون مفيدة جدا جدا ، معلومات تخليك فاهم الحاجه ال بتعلمها فعلا ، وثقه للشخص كدا أنه يكون فاهم كويس ال بيكتبه ، ربنا يجازيكم خير ❤️❤️
×
![Preview Image]()
كيف كانت تجربتك؟ نود أن نعرف!
سجل دخولك للتقييم
تشغيل الفيديو

39 درس

5 أقسام

25 مختصر كتابي

شهادة موثقة

الانضمام لمجموعة دراسية حصرية

متابعة شخصية

قياس مستوى التقدم والانجاز عبر الدورة

إجابة من قبل المعلم على كل الأسئلة

فاعليات حصرية

شارات تميز للطلبة المتقدمين

اشعارات تذكير وتحفيز لإنهاء الدورة
الأسئلة الشائعة
Cascading Style Sheets (CSS) هي المكملة للصورة الجمالية لصفحة الويب عن طريق تنسيق الخطوط، وإضافة الألوان، والمؤثرات الخاصة، وغيرها من الميزات التي تجعل شكل الصفحة أكثر جمالًا؛ لذلك يمكنك القول إن CSS هي المسؤولة عن تنسيق شكل صفحات الويب والمواقع.
يتم استخدام HTML لتصميم هيكل الصفحة، كالصفحة التي أنت فيها الآن. وHTML هي مزيج من نص تشعبي (Hypertext) ولغة ترميز (Markup language). النص التشعبي يحدد الرابط بين صفحات الويب، ولغة الترميز تُستخدم لتعريف وثائق النص (text documentation).
تهدف CSS إلى جعل صفحات الويب قابلة للعرض (presentable)؛ حيث تسمح لك CSS بتطبيق الأنماط (styles) على صفحات الويب، وذلك بشكل مستقل عن HTML التي تشكل كل صفحة ويب.
لذا فإن تعلم كلتا اللغتين HTML و CSS يعتبر من الأشياء الأساسية لكل مطوري صفحات الويب Web developers.
يُمكنك تعلم CSS باتباع الخطوات التالية:
1- فهم أساسيات HTML: قبل تعلم CSS، يجب أن يكون لديك فهم جيد لأساسيات HTML، حيث يتم استخدام CSS لتنسيق عناصر HTML وتنسيقها.
2- ممارسة كتابة كود CSS: أفضل طريقة لتعلم CSS هي من خلال التدرب على كتابة الكود والبرمجة. يمكنك البدء بإنشاء صفحات ويب بسيطة والانتقال تدريجيًا إلى مشاريع أكثر تعقيدًا.
3- تعلم أطر عمل CSS: توفر أطر CSS مثل Bootstrap وFoundation و tailwind css كود CSS مكتوب مسبقًا يمكنك استخدامه لتصميم صفحات الويب الخاصة بك بسرعة وسهولة. يمكن أن يوفر لك تعلم هذه الأطر الوقت والجهد في عملية التصميم.
وستجد هذا وأكثر من خلال هذه الدورة “CSS fundamentals”، والدورة القادمة “CCS layout”.
تُستخدم CSS متى أردت تطبيق التصميم والتنسيق على عناصر HTML في صفحة الويب. وفيما يلي بعض الحالات التي يجب فيها استخدام CSS:
1- لتصميم عناصر HTML: يتم استخدام CSS لإضافة أنماط مثل الخطوط والألوان وصور الخلفية والتخطيط إلى عناصر HTML.
2- لإنشاء تصميمات سريعة الاستجابة: يمكن استخدام CSS لإنشاء تصميمات سريعة الاستجابة تتكيف مع أحجام الشاشات والأجهزة المختلفة.
3- لإنشاء الرسوم المتحركة والانتقالات (Animations & Transitions): يمكن استخدام CSS لإنشاء الرسوم المتحركة والانتقالات التي تضيف التفاعل المرئي إلى صفحة الويب.
4- للحفاظ على التناسق (consistency): يمكن استخدام CSS لإنشاء تصميم متسق عبر صفحات أو أقسام متعددة من موقع الويب.
5- لتحسين أداء موقع الويب: يمكن استخدام CSS لتحسين أداء موقع الويب وسرعته في تحميل الصفحات.
يختلف وقت تعلم أساسيات CSS من شخص لآخر نتيجةً لاختلاف الظروف والوقت المتاح لكل شخص، ولكن في المتوسط، فإن دورة أساسيات CSS هذه يُتوقع الانتهاء منها في خلال أسبوعين تقريبًا.
اعجبني فيها الشرح البسيط والمفهوم ومن ثم اذا لم تفهم من الكلام يوجد هناك شرح مختصر كتابي واعجبني ايضا الكتابات المرفقة على الفيديو اثناء الشرح بحيث يكتب الكلمة التي ينطقها وهنا ان لم تفهمها او لم تسمعها جيدا فهي مكتوبة على الفيديو اثناء نطقه لها من ثم يوجد هناك زر لاضافة الملاحظات ان كنت بحاجة لكتابة الكلمة لترجمتها او لحفظها والتحديات والاختبارات بحيث انك تكون دقيق جدا لانها مسجله كلها في حسابك.